三种解法 1.使用内连接 select u.name as u_n, c.name as c_n, l.date as d from login as l inner join user as u on l.user_id=u.id inner join client as c on l.client_id=c.id inner join ( select user_id, max(date) as date from login group by user_id ) a on l.user_id=a.user_id and l.date=a.date order by u.name asc ...